So now that I'm ready to get things back together in my truck, I'm wanting to get the turbo and everything else back in after work today. I have a bypassed exhaust fitting where thd butterfly flap used to be, with freeze plug in it and it's been ceramic coated, along with a ceramic coated 1.0 housing. I would like to remove the EBPV piece from the pedestal but not sure if it's as easy as I just pull the snap ring off and then pull the stuff out, put that brass colored cap back in with the snap ring, and then plug that tiny hole on the other side. Are there oil passages that I will have issues with if I just gut it and plug it? Ive read that quite a few people have done just that. Worst case scenario I will just leave it with the rod sticking out and it's not hooked up to anything. That's how it was in my truck when I started pulling everything a few weeks ago.
